Midwest Minnesota Community Development Corporation
Information by Research TrustFinance
Midwest Minnesota Community Development Corporation (MMCDC) is a nonprofit community development corporation (CDC) and a certified Community Development Financial Institution (CDFI) incorporated in 1971. Its mission is to provide capital and support to help people, businesses, and communities prosper in rural Minnesota and North Dakota. The organization focuses on three main areas: business development through flexible financing and consulting for entrepreneurs, housing development by financing and building affordable homes and apartments, and various community initiatives to strengthen local economies.
